Ganesha Jayanti 2026 date, rituals, meaning and wishes guide
Ganesha Jayanti, also known as Magha Vinayak or Maghi Ganpati, is a Hindu festival for Lord Ganesha. It is treated as his birth celebration. Devotees mark the day with Ganesh puja, home and temple worship, and offerings of modak, seeking wisdom, success, and the removal of obstacles.
Ganesha Jayanti has a strong base in Maharashtra and the Konkan region, where it is called Maghi Ganpati. It falls on Magha Shukla Chaturthi and is seen as the birth day of Ganesha. This keeps it distinct from Ganesh Chaturthi, which comes in the Bhadrapada month in the Hindu calendar.

Rituals and How Ganesha Jayanti is Celebrated
On Ganesha Jayanti, people follow Ganesh puja at home or in temples. The worship can be simple or more detailed. The "path" often includes Ganesh Atharvashirsha, which is very common. Many also recite a Ganapati stotra and a birth style story that tells how Ganesha is honoured first.
In Maharashtra, some homes and temples treat Ganesha Jayanti like a smaller Ganesh festival. They install or adorn a Ganesha idol. They offer modak as naivedya during puja. Devotees may read local Ganesha Jayanti katha booklets and end the worship with aarti, closing the ritual with song and light.
Dress choices for Ganesha Jayanti often follow the given guide of yellow or red attire. These colours are used by devotees and can also appear in decorations for idols and puja spaces. Modak is listed as the main food. It is offered to Ganesha before being shared as prasad.
